

Corelight Open NDR and Lumu compete in the network detection and response space. Corelight Open NDR appears superior in features and deployment, while Lumu offers competitive pricing with strong customer support.
Features: Corelight Open NDR supports advanced packet analysis, comprehensive integration capabilities, and provides deeper data visibility. Lumu is notable for precise threat intelligence, automated response features, and quick actionable insights.
Room for Improvement: Corelight Open NDR could simplify its deployment process and reduce initial setup costs. It may also benefit from enhancing customer accessibility to its insights. Lumu could expand on providing more detailed initial threat visibility and further integrate with more cybersecurity platforms, despite its ease of use.
Ease of Deployment and Customer Service: Corelight Open NDR requires a more involved deployment process but benefits from extensive technical support, ensuring a comprehensive integration. Lumu offers a lightweight, intuitive deployment model and responsive customer service, which facilitates faster integration into existing infrastructures.
Pricing and ROI: Corelight Open NDR involves higher initial costs but offers substantial ROI due to high-level security analysis. Lumu provides a cost-effective solution with minimal setup costs, promising strong ROI due to efficient threat detection capabilities.

Corelight Open NDR delivers rapid deployment, essential insight, and data for cybersecurity. Known for ease of use, cost-effectiveness, and open-source Zeek code, it enhances security by streamlining traffic monitoring and integrating with threat feeds.
Corelight Open NDR offers organizations enhanced network security and visibility, utilizing physical sensors in addition to cloud, virtual, and software variants. It supports incident response with packet capture sampling, monitoring internet, data center, and LAN traffic while facilitating east-west traffic identification. Despite its complexity, users suggest architectural simplifications and a graphical interface to boost usability and reduce costs. Features like Smart PCAP and service catalogs contribute positively, but an interactive interface with more seamless feature access is desired.
What Are Corelight Open NDR's Key Features?Primarily utilized by organizations to bolster network security, Corelight Open NDR is deployed in various sectors to increase visibility and streamline incident response. Its deployment spans physical, cloud, virtual, and software models, focusing on comprehensive packet capture sampling for effective traffic monitoring. Across industries, it serves managed services by identifying lateral network traffic, optimizing internet, data center, and LAN performance.
Lumu detects and validates network compromises by analyzing metadata like DNS, NetFlow, and proxy logs. It provides real-time indicators and context to enhance detection, improve threat visibility, and reduce investigation time.
Lumu offers organizations a streamlined solution to identify network compromises through comprehensive metadata analysis, including DNS, NetFlow, and proxy logs. By providing real-time compromise indicators alongside contextual information, Lumu elevates threat visibility and shortens investigation durations. Its simple interface and integration flexibility with platforms, alongside automated incident responses, highlight its value. While users appreciate limited false positives, ease of use, and the context provided, enhancements in SIEM and XDR integration, asset context enrichment, and reporting are areas users would like to see further developed.
What features define Lumu?Organizations use Lumu to monitor outbound traffic, detect compromised endpoints, log firewall activities, and enable active threat blocking. Its integration ease via API supports threat detection across LAN and Wi-Fi, monitoring email traffic, and acting as a managed SOC for security event coordination. Companies appreciate Lumu's adaptability in hybrid environments and its ability to efficiently locate and analyze threats within network metadata, ensuring quick deployment and extendibility across external platforms.
